Making screensavers and other goodies using open-source Screenweaver

I've been playing around with Screenweaver OS lately. Now that it's been released as an open-source project, who can resist a readily available means of making real, honest-to-goodness desktop applications from Flash?

Of course, that doesn't mean I've done anything earthshattering yet, but I've at least been playing around with its simple-to-use screensaver building tools. I originally released this screensaver on another Web site devoted to the Volvo 1800 automobile, but I figured I'd place it here in case anyone else was interested. The 3d model was designed by Josh Isaacson for Turdhead.com and will later appear in one of Turdhead's game-o'-the-month features, as well as one or more Classic1800.com utilities.

Not much to say about it, but I figured it might get a few others' interests peaked in both Screenweaver development and my favorite classic Volvo sports car. Happy motoring!
